Jan 5, 2024 - Nuclear Power - Bruce Power In Ontario



The Bruce Nuclear Plant on the Lake Huron is a massive complex, one of the biggest in the world. We travel to Kincardine Ontario to go explore the visitor center and learn more about nuclear power and the technology behind it. There are many facets to nuclear power; CANDU reactors, fuel bundles, isotopes, and disposal. Heavy water is used to moderate the nuclear reaction as well as heat the light water to produce steam. The cooling water is used to condense the steam back to fluid, completing the rankine cycle.
